Naturally, the thought of bark collars come to mind, but keep in mind, there are three different kinds to choose from. Regardless of which method you choose, the principle is the same. When the dog barks, the collar is activated and a form of correction ensues, stopping the pattern of barking. The three different types of collar emissions include citronella spray, tone correction and stimulation. Your dog will not need to wear these collars forever, just until he’s trained properly. However, don’t throw them away or sell them on Ebay as your dog may need to be re-trained again in the future.
First mentioned was the citronella collar. This collar will shoot out a spray of non-harmful but unpleasant smelling citronella in front of the dog’s face interrupting his barking stream. Many pet owners report excellent results with this type of deterrent. The tone emitting collar will let out a loud sound to distract the dog and will shut off when the dog stops barking. This collar also has a remote control that will allow the owner to turn it on manually when they hear the dog barking. Lastly, is the stimulation collar that shoots out an electrical charge when it senses the dog barking. They are considered safe to the dog and different charge levels can be chosen. Increased levels only work when the dog continues his barking.

There are 3 different types of No Bark Collars 1)No Bark Shock Collars: These types of Bark Collars provide a small shock to the dog when they bark. Many have variable stimulation levels and some have progressive stimulation which will increase the level of the static shock if the dog disregards the initial correction, Almost all No Bark Collars are activated by the sound the dog makes when it barks but the better models also include a Vibration Sensor which works in concert with the sound sensor so that other dogs barking do not activate the collar. 2)Spray Bark Collars: These types of Bark Collars are equipped with a can of pressured spray which activates when the dog barks. The spray is available in various scents and can be an effective, depending on the demeanor of your dog and how often they bark. Much like Shock Dog Bark Collars, not all of these collars are equipped with Vibration Sensors, so take your time when choosing the right collar. 3)Ultrasonic Bark Collars: These collars emit an ultrasonic correction that only your dog can hear. Considered the least of effective of the 3 types of Bark Collars. Of course the most effective one is the one that is best suited for your dog, depending on it size and how often it barks. Take the time to research the proper model and you will find whats best for you.

A very new product is on the market today. It is a painless and safe way to stop your dog, and even your neighbor’s dog from barking. It is a remote control device. All you need to do is press the button. The device gives off a high pitch sound that only dogs can hear. As soon as the dog hears this, he will stop barking. The bark control device can be used for the neighbor’s dog so the distance of this device travels. Another bark control device that is very similar works with an ultrasonic signal, also not heard by human ears. This device simply needs to be turned on, left in the house, and when the dog starts to bark it automatically gives off the signal. The dog hears it, and bark control is safely and painlessly in effect. This can also work for dogs outside and nearby. There are also dog collars made for bark control. When the dog is wearing the collar, and begins to bark, one of the three correction methods go into play. There are collars that use tone, stimulation and even a citronella spray. The tone collars emit a sound similar to the remote control device. The stimulation collars emit a static electrical impulse. Citronella spray collars emit an unpleasant spray of citronella right in front of the dog’s face. This spray is harmless to your pet. All of these collars will only work on the dog who is wearing it, not any other dogs that may be nearby. There has been some controversy regarding the stimulation collars, but they are still considered safe. However, considering all of the other choices of bark control, this collar isn’t even needed.

In my opinion, the PetSafe No Bark Collar will not harm your dog. The PetSafe Bark-control collar delivers a harmless static shock to the dog whenever it barks. It is designed to train a dog, not punish it. Therefore, the shocks are not strong enough to cause harm. According to a university study of the PetSafe No-Bark Collar, involving adult shelter dogs, there were no no long-term adverse effects, and and all of the dogs reduced their barking by the second day. PetSafe also offers an alternative collar, that uses a harmless spray instead of a static shock as a bark deterrent.
